How they compare
Somalia currently reports 5.2% against 4.9% in Liberia, a difference of 0.3%.
That makes Somalia's figure about 1.1 times Liberia's.
Across all 6 years both countries report, Somalia has been ahead every year.
Liberia ranks 36th and Somalia ranks 33rd of 185 countries.
Somalia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Number of male deaths ages 60+ due to injury divided by number of all male deaths ages 60+, expressed by percentage. Injury includes unintentional and intentional injuries.
